What is Afghan Afghani (AFN)

The Afghan afghani (AFN) is the official currency of Afghanistan. Introduced in 1925, the afghani has undergone several changes, particularly due to the political and economic conditions of the country. Made up of 100 puls, the afghani is available in both coin and banknote forms. The currency symbolizes the resilience of the Afghan people and their economy, which has faced numerous challenges over the decades.

The afghani is often represented by the symbol "؋" and the ISO code "AFN." It is crucial to note that the value of the afghani can fluctuate significantly due to Afghanistan's complex geopolitical landscape. As a result, individuals and businesses engaging in trade or travel often need to monitor exchange rates closely. The Central Bank of Afghanistan, Da Afghanistan Bank, is responsible for issuing and regulating the currency.

What is Sierra Leonean Leone (SLL)

The Sierra Leonean leone (SLL) is the official currency of Sierra Leone, a country located on the West coast of Africa. The leone was first introduced in 1964, taking over from the pound as the nation's means of exchange. Similar to the afghani, the leone is subdivided into 100 cents.

Represented by the symbol "Le" and the ISO code "SLL," the currency has seen its share of challenges, including severe inflation and economic difficulties in recent years. The Bank of Sierra Leone is tasked with the issuance and regulation of the leone, ensuring stability within the economy. Like the afghani, the value of the leone can experience significant fluctuations, making it essential for anyone looking to convert currencies to stay informed about current exchange rates.

Converting AFN to SLL

Converting Afghan afghani (AFN) to Sierra Leonean leone (SLL) can be an important transaction for businesses, travelers, or expatriates living in either country. The exchange rate between the two currencies can vary based on numerous factors, including economic policy, political stability, and market demand.

To convert AFN to SLL, one must determine the current exchange rate. This rate is typically influenced by the foreign exchange market and can fluctuate daily. The conversion can be represented with the formula:

Amount in SLL = Amount in AFN × Exchange Rate (SLL/AFN)

It's advisable to consult reliable financial institutions, currency exchange platforms, or online converters for the most accurate and up-to-date rates before making any transactions. Additionally, be aware of any fees or commissions that may apply during the exchange process.
